French Credit Card Hacker Discusses His Crimes After Two Decades. A Conversation With Serge Humpich.
About this episode
Serge Humpich is a hacker who discovered a flaw in the Carte Bleue system used in France for credit cards. He tried to warn banks, but was unsuccessful, and therefore decided to perform a public "show" where he bought subway tickets while using the flaw in the card system. He was convicted in 2000 to a ten months suspended sentence, and lost his job as a result of the case. In this episode, Humpich joins host Heather Engel to discuss his experience, the ethical hacking landscape over 25 years later, and more. • For more on cybersecurity, visit us at https://cybersecurityventures.com
